Transaction 833e96a222f7d245ba2bf38fe6f3e60041162a2d8e569a4e94864297d14d5f7e
1 Input
1 Output
-
833e96a222f7d245ba2bf38fe6f3e60041162a2d8e569a4e94864297d14d5f7e:0
- value
- 75614231
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c9ceb2c24d5c00e9f5ccb96d266aa6dc86424ce
- address
- bc1qfjwwktpy6hqqa86uewtdye42dhyxgfxwqynhzh